What RTP Means for Agent Jane Blonde Returns Players

RTP — return to player — represents the theoretical percentage of wagered money a slot returns over millions of spins. For a deeper explanation of the mechanics, see What Is Rtp In Slots. At 96.45%, Agent Jane Blonde Returns is projected to return £96.45 for every £100 wagered across an extended session. In practical terms, a UK player wagering £5 per spin across 100 spins (£500 total) might theoretically recover around £482, though actual results will deviate significantly in the short term. Because Games Global has not published an official volatility rating for this slot, session swings are harder to predict than for labelled high-volatility titles. RTP is a long-run statistical measure — in a short session of 50 to 100 spins, volatility has far more influence on your balance than the RTP figure alone.

Why Agent Jane Blonde Returns's RTP Varies By Casino

Games Global, like most major suppliers, ships Agent Jane Blonde Returns with multiple configurable RTP versions. UKGC licensing requires operators to disclose the RTP available on their specific configuration, but it does not oblige them to offer the highest available variant. This means the 96.45% figure represents the top-tier configuration — some casinos may run a lower version, such as 94% or 95%, without any visible signpost on the lobby page. Players can verify the active RTP by opening the in-game information or paytable panel before wagering real money. What does a 96.45% RTP mean in pound terms for Agent Jane Blonde Returns?
A 96.45% RTP means that, theoretically, for every £100 wagered on Agent Jane Blonde Returns over a very large number of spins, the game returns approximately £96.45. Over 1,000 spins at £1 per spin — £1,000 wagered — the theoretical return is around £964.50, implying a theoretical loss of £35.50. These are long-run statistical averages; actual short-session results will vary considerably depending on the outcome of individual spins and the slot's unpublished variance characteristics.
